<div. onload>是一個HTML和JavaScript中常用的屬性,它用于在一個HTML文件加載完畢后執行特定的任務。通過div. onload,我們能夠在頁面中的某個特定div元素完全加載之后,調用JavaScript函數來進行進一步的操作。在本文中,我們將詳細介紹div. onload的使用,并提供一些示例代碼來更好地理解該屬性的功能和用法。
<div. onload>屬性通常用于在頁面元素完全加載之后執行特定的任務。這對于需要等待某個元素加載完成后再執行操作的情況非常有用。與body. onload屬性不同,div. onload只針對頁面中的特定div元素進行操作,因此可以更加精確地控制頁面的加載和處理流程。
下面我們通過幾個代碼案例來詳細解釋<div. onload>的用法。
示例1:當div元素加載完畢后,在控制臺輸出一句話。
在上述示例中,我們定義了一個名為divLoaded()的JavaScript函數,在函數中使用console.log()方法輸出一條信息。然后,在div元素的onload屬性中調用了這個函數。當這個div元素加載完成后,divLoaded()函數將被觸發,并在控制臺中輸出一條信息。
示例2:動態改變div元素的樣式。
在上述示例中,我們定義了一個名為changeStyle()的JavaScript函數,在函數中通過修改div元素的style屬性,將背景顏色從紅色改為藍色。然后,在div元素的onload屬性中調用了這個函數。當這個div元素加載完成后,changeStyle()函數將被觸發,并改變div元素的樣式。
通過以上兩個示例,我們可以清楚地看到<div. onload>的用法和效果。可以根據實際需求,定義相關的JavaScript函數,然后將這些函數與div元素的onload屬性關聯起來,以達到在div元素加載完成后執行特定任務的目的。
需要注意的是,由于<div. onload>屬性不被所有瀏覽器支持,因此在編寫代碼時應考慮兼容性問題。除了<div. onload>之外,還可以通過其他方式實現類似的功能,例如使用jQuery等庫。在實際開發中,應根據具體情況選擇最適合的方法來實現所需功能。
來說,<div. onload>是一個非常有用的屬性,可以在頁面中的特定div元素加載完畢后執行特定的任務。通過示例代碼,我們詳細說明了<div. onload>的用法和功能。希望本文能夠幫助讀者更好地理解并掌握這一屬性的使用方法。
<div. onload>屬性通常用于在頁面元素完全加載之后執行特定的任務。這對于需要等待某個元素加載完成后再執行操作的情況非常有用。與body. onload屬性不同,div. onload只針對頁面中的特定div元素進行操作,因此可以更加精確地控制頁面的加載和處理流程。
下面我們通過幾個代碼案例來詳細解釋<div. onload>的用法。
示例1:當div元素加載完畢后,在控制臺輸出一句話。
<!DOCTYPE html> <html> <head> <title>Example 1</title> <script> function divLoaded() { console.log("The div is loaded!"); } </script> </head> <body> <div onload="divLoaded()"> This is a div element. </div> </body> </html>
在上述示例中,我們定義了一個名為divLoaded()的JavaScript函數,在函數中使用console.log()方法輸出一條信息。然后,在div元素的onload屬性中調用了這個函數。當這個div元素加載完成后,divLoaded()函數將被觸發,并在控制臺中輸出一條信息。
示例2:動態改變div元素的樣式。
<!DOCTYPE html> <html> <head> <title>Example 2</title> <style> #myDiv { width: 200px; height: 200px; background-color: red; } </style> <script> function changeStyle() { document.getElementById("myDiv").style.backgroundColor = "blue"; } </script> </head> <body> <div id="myDiv" onload="changeStyle()"> This is a div element. </div> </body> </html>
在上述示例中,我們定義了一個名為changeStyle()的JavaScript函數,在函數中通過修改div元素的style屬性,將背景顏色從紅色改為藍色。然后,在div元素的onload屬性中調用了這個函數。當這個div元素加載完成后,changeStyle()函數將被觸發,并改變div元素的樣式。
通過以上兩個示例,我們可以清楚地看到<div. onload>的用法和效果。可以根據實際需求,定義相關的JavaScript函數,然后將這些函數與div元素的onload屬性關聯起來,以達到在div元素加載完成后執行特定任務的目的。
需要注意的是,由于<div. onload>屬性不被所有瀏覽器支持,因此在編寫代碼時應考慮兼容性問題。除了<div. onload>之外,還可以通過其他方式實現類似的功能,例如使用jQuery等庫。在實際開發中,應根據具體情況選擇最適合的方法來實現所需功能。
來說,<div. onload>是一個非常有用的屬性,可以在頁面中的特定div元素加載完畢后執行特定的任務。通過示例代碼,我們詳細說明了<div. onload>的用法和功能。希望本文能夠幫助讀者更好地理解并掌握這一屬性的使用方法。
上一篇css文字不被點擊事件
下一篇div_fre